Search for "humulus"

Humulus lupulus Magnum
Humulus lupulus 'Magnum'
£19.99
1.5 litre pot In stock (shipped within 2-3 working days)
Humulus lupulus Aureus
Humulus lupulus 'Aureus'
£29.99
3 litre pot available to order from autumn

Copyright © Crocus.co.uk Ltd 2025. All rights reserved.